What is a residual or balloon?
A balloon payment is a larger final payment left at the end of a loan term, which keeps the regular repayments lower. Residual value is the amount still owing on a leased asset at the end of the term. Either way, you pay it out, refinance it or sell the asset to clear it.
Setting a residual or balloon in this calculator lowers the estimated repayment and raises what is owing at the end, and the honest comparison is both numbers together. Finance for equipment, vehicles and other assets
Asset finance suits equipment, vehicles and other business assets, from machinery and tools to utes, vans and trucks. The amount financed is the price less any deposit or trade-in. A residual or balloon lowers the regular repayment by leaving a lump sum owing at the end of the term, which you then pay out, refinance or clear by selling the asset. A larger residual means smaller repayments but more owing at the end, so it is a trade-off worth modelling before you commit.
